Create a Seized Goods Marketplace

Police and government seizure auctions allow municipalities and law enforcement agencies to convert confiscated and forfeited property into public revenue. From vehicles and jewelry to electronics and tools, these auctions attract competitive bidding while offering the public access to valuable goods at below-retail prices.
